
Drone navigation
Drone navigation involves guiding a drone through its environment accurately and safely. It uses a combination of sensors like GPS, cameras, and accelerometers to determine its position and detect obstacles. The drone’s onboard computer processes this data to plan paths, avoid objects, and reach designated points. Advanced navigation can include pre-set routes or real-time adjustments to changing conditions, allowing the drone to operate autonomously or via remote control. This technology enables drones to perform tasks such as aerial photography, delivery, or inspection efficiently, with precision and reliability.
